Transaction

e61ac569eaeee66513d0df4a6dde10a8d56391eddc23f5b79fa22f04cf2584bd
363,581 confirmations
Timestamp
1557120515
Block574,796
Fee567 sats
Fee rate2.53 sats/vB
view on mempool.space

Inputs & Outputs